How they compare

IBRD only currently reports 4,868 Mt CO2e against 689.15 Mt CO2e in India, a difference of 4,179 Mt CO2e.

That makes IBRD only's figure about 7.1 times India's.

Across all 55 years both countries report, IBRD only has been ahead every year.

IBRD only ranks 3rd and India ranks 2nd of 45 groups.

IBRD only has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ade IBRD only India Difference Ahead
1970s 1,455 Mt CO2e 72.09 Mt CO2e 1,383 Mt CO2e IBRD only
1980s 1,847 Mt CO2e 115.76 Mt CO2e 1,732 Mt CO2e IBRD only
1990s 2,025 Mt CO2e 163.5 Mt CO2e 1,862 Mt CO2e IBRD only
2000s 2,914 Mt CO2e 245.27 Mt CO2e 2,668 Mt CO2e IBRD only
2010s 4,567 Mt CO2e 496.64 Mt CO2e 4,070 Mt CO2e IBRD only
2020s 4,695 Mt CO2e 613.1 Mt CO2e 4,082 Mt CO2e IBRD only

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

A measure of annual emissions of carbon dioxide (CO2), one of the six Kyoto greenhouse gases (GHG), from industrial combustion (subsector of the energy sector) including IPCC 2006 code 1.A.2 Manufacturing Industries and Construction.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
